In the game "Skyrim" there is a huge variety of armor and weapons, which you can make or find in the process of passing. And each of them differs in power or protective characteristics. But it's no secret that the best equipment is Dragon Armor. There are many dangers in Skyrim, but this armor will help protect you from even the most bloodthirsty monsters.

Characteristics

Dragon armor in Skyrim consists of two sets - heavy and light armor. Each one includes a helmet, cuirass, boots, gloves, and shield. And each of these things has increased durability and a level of protection that has practically no analogues in the Skyrim game. The Dragonbone mod adds the ability to create not only improved versions of this armor, but also allows you to forge the same “lethal” weapons: bone and scaly swords and daggers, axes and axes, bows, hammers, and arrows. So get ready for the fact that you will need to kill dragons in batches.

The basic characteristics that dragon armor has in Skyrim are quite high on their own, in addition, they can be improved at the workbench. To do this, you will need bones or dragon scales, depending on whether you want to upgrade light or heavy armor.

Do not even hope to accidentally find Dragon armor in Skyrim, because such armor does not lie in chests or boxes. In addition, they are not worn by opponents, so taking it from a corpse will not work. Also, no merchant will sell you such things. But it is not all that bad. You will get such sets thanks to the pumping of "blacksmithing". Of course, in order for this armor to become available to you, you will need to learn this skill as much as possible. In addition, you will need to open the entire branch of heavy or light armor and kill a lot of dragons, because to create such armor you will need their bones and scales in a considerable amount.

For example, to make a light cuirass, you need to have four pieces of dragon scales. And to create the entire set of such armor, you need to have 14 "scales" of winged beasts. The situation is even worse with "heavy" armor. Get ready for the fact that such Dragon Armor in Skyrim, or rather the creation of a complete set of shell armor, will require you to have 6 pieces of bones and 13 “scales”, and this is only “clothes” without weapons. So you have to travel a lot around the neighborhood in search of "materials".

Cheats and codes

Certainly, console commands are not considered a "fair" way to obtain a particular resource in any game. But what to do if you want to get a set of dragon armor right now, and don’t want to pump blacksmithing or scour the game in search of winged monsters? In this case, you can use special console commands that will immediately add the items you need to your inventory. In order to use this method, you need to open the game console. You can do this with the "~" key. Next, you need to write a special command player.additem and add the item code and quantity to it. Cheats for scaly armor:

  • Breastplate - 0001393E.
  • Boots - 0001393D.
  • Gloves - 0001393F.
  • Helmet - 00013940.
  • Shield - 00013941.

Armor set:

  • Breastplate - 00013966.
  • Boots - 00013965.
  • Gloves - 00013967.
  • Helmet - 00013969.
  • Shield - 00013968.

For example, in order to get armored gloves, you need to write the following command: player.additem 00013967 1. So in a simple way you can get any thing even at the initial levels of the game.

The first add-on (DLC) to TES V: Skyrim - "Dawnguard" added weapons from dragon bones, and the ability to create them (for this you need 100 blacksmithing and the unlocked ability of dragon armor). This type of weapon is the most powerful in the game, and now you can put on a complete dragon set: armor and weapons.

To create any dragon weapon, you need: strips of leather, ebony ingots and dragon bones.

To upgrade dragon weapons, you need dragon bones.

Briefly about the add-on

With the release of the first DLC "Dawnguard" for the beloved game from the series The Elder Scrolls, players have gained the ability to loot dragon weapons and armor made almost entirely of dragon bone. In addition, the developers have also added the ability to create them.

But, of course, only if you have the appropriate resources and skills (level 100 of blacksmithing and a pumped ability in the “dragon armor” branch of development).

Dragon weapons in Skyrim, with their arrival in the game world, took the honorable first place in it in terms of the amount of damage done, but even if the damage still seems too small to you, you can always improve your weapon using a grindstone, of course, if you have one dragon bone.

The weight of this weapon is also noticeably higher, not to mention the exorbitant price for it.

Forging such a powerful weapon requires materials that are far from the easiest way to get, more specifically, you need dragon bones, ebonite ingots and pieces of leather. Arrows can be crafted at the forge if you have at least one log at your disposal (1 log = 24 arrows).

List of weapons

Below are all the dragon weapons in Skyrim at the moment:

Dragonbone Dagger - Possesses the highest performance of his class. To create it, you need: x1 dragon bone, x1 piece of leather;

You can find it on the caretakers who live in the Cairn of Souls.

Dragon bone sword - has powerful damage, but is inferior in performance to Miraak's sword. When pumping up to the fortieth level, there is a small chance of being randomly found in various things. From level 41, an enchanted version of it can come across.

To create it, you need: x1 dragon bone, x1 ebonite ingot, x1 piece of leather;

The dragonbone battle ax is the most powerful and very heavy among its class.
When pumping up to the fortieth level, there is a small chance of being randomly found in various things. From level 41, an enchanted version of it can come across.
You can find it on the caretakers who live in the Cairn of Souls.
To create it, you need: x1 dragon bone, x1 ebonite ingot, x2 piece of leather;

The Dragonbone Mace is the most powerful and heaviest weapon in its class.

To create it, you need: x2 dragon bones, x1 ebonite ingot, x1 piece of leather;

Dragonbone two-handed sword - has the highest damage among other two-handed swords, including those added in other add-ons from official developers.
When pumping up to the fortieth level, there is a small chance of being randomly found in various things. From level 41, an enchanted version of it can come across.

You can find a two-handed sword on the caretakers who live in the Cairn of Souls.

To create it, you need: x4 dragon bones, x1 ebonite ingot, x3 piece of leather;

Dragon bone ax - has the most powerful damage among other axes, including those added in other add-ons from official developers. The only drawback is that it weighs a lot.
When pumping up to the fortieth level, there is a small chance of being randomly found in various things. From level 41, an enchanted version of her can come across.

You can find it on the caretakers who live in the Cairn of Souls.

To create it, you need: x3 dragon bones, x2 ebonite ingot, x2 piece of leather;

Two-Handed Dragonbone Warhammer - has powerful characteristics among other two-handed warhammers, second only to the "giant's club".
When pumping up to the fortieth level, there is a small chance of being randomly found in various things. From level 41, an enchanted version of it can come across.

You can find a two-handed warhammer on the caretakers who live in the Cairn of Souls.

To create it, you need: x3 dragon bones, x2 ebonite ingot, x3 piece of leather;

Dragon bone bow powerful weapon of his class.
When pumping up to the fortieth level, there is a small chance of being randomly found in various things. From level 41, an enchanted version of it can come across.

You can find a dragonbone bow on the caretakers who live in the Cairn of Souls.

To create it, you need: x2 dragon bones, x1 ebonite ingot;

The Dragonbone Arrow is the most expensive and powerful arrow in the game.
There is a small chance to find in containers, but only from level 46.

Of the three Overseers, one of them may have these arrows. The Watchers themselves dwell in the Cairn of Souls. Also,
sometimes arrows can drop from a Dwemer centurion.

Description:
Adds a weapon set with two texture versions. One set is dirty and a bit rusty, the other is clean with minor signs of wear. The set includes a bow, arrows, battle axe, axe, war hammer, two-handed sword, one-handed sword, mace, hammer and dagger. The dirty version has "(rusty)" at the end. There is a version without level-lists.

Update:1.01
- Now the mod archive can be installed via NMM / MO managers
- The version of the mod without level-lists is now available via an additional link separately.

Where to find:
They can be crafted at the forge in the "Dragon" section. A clean weapon has 2 points more damage than a Daedric one, a worn version is equal in damage. Weapons can be enchanted and sharpened. Worn versions begin to appear in the game at level 40 and can be smelted into a clean one. Also added two chests, both well hidden. One is on the way to Wind Peak, and the other is somewhere near the exit from it. The first contains the rusty version, the second the clean one. There is a version of the esp-file without level-lists, in a separate folder.
